HC Deb 04 December 1985 vol 88 cc267-8W
Mr. Campbell-Savours

asked the Secretary of State for the Environment what was the total borrowing outstanding in respect of each local authority as at 1 April 1985.

Mr. Waldegrave

I have today placed in the Library a table showing the total borrowing outstanding at 31 March 1985 in respect of each local authority in England for which the information is available. The borrowing is defined as external debt administered by the authority, including debt administered on behalf of other local authorities and public bodies. The sources of the figures are in most cases the CIPFA questionnaire on capital expenditure and debt financing statistics for 1984–85 (for long-term borrowing) and the DOE borrowing and lending inquiry for March 1985 (for short-term borrowing). In cases where authorities have not returned the CIPFA questionnaire for 1984–85 figures have where possible been updated from the 1983–84 questionnaire using the DOE borrowing and lending inquiries for the intervening period.

Mr. Campbell-Savours

asked the Secretary of State for the Environment what information he has as to which local authorities have borrowings outstanding to foreign banks and as to the value in each case.

Mr. Waldegrave

Local authorities provide information in aggregate form on the extent of their borrowing from and repayments to overseas lenders. This information does not distinguish banks from other overseas bodies. Details of individual authorities' transactions of the sort are subject to commercial confidentiality.
